Charles Silver: An Auteurist History of Film Film Size_35mm ” — David MaiselBeginning in 2009, The Museum of Modern Art offered a weekly series of film screenings titled An Auteurist History of Film. Inspired by Andrew Sarris seminal work The American Cinema, which developed on the idea of "auteur theory" first discussed by the critics of Cahiers du Cinma in the 1950s, the series presented cinematic works from MoMAs expansive collection with particular focus on the role of the director as artistic author.
